Hearth of the home. |
The owner wanted the television at eye level and the cupboard in oak to match the oak floor, which incidentally I laid 10 years ago.
He also wanted an oak mantelpiece. This could have been done in many different ways, but having a floating shelf brings the whole room bang up to date, leaving clean lines, so the area does not look cluttered. The stove is quite contemporary, but having a wood burner and using traditional materials such as oak and stone, makes a contemporary statement fit into a 100 year old home.
